  1. Ok, If you're like me, and ordered an MKZ, you're probably going crazy from the lack of useful information coming from your dealer. It seems the internet knows a lot more than the average guy, so here's some tips I have found that helped me go less crazy: #1 Get your VIN. If there's no VIN on your vehicle yet, you've got a long way to go. I'm afraid, you've got a while to go. #2 The dealer should be able to pull the VIN once your order is processed... You might have to ask him more than once... It takes a couple of weeks after the order apparently... Once you have the VIN, keep trying it at this web site: http://fordlabels.webview.biz/webviewhybrid/WindowSticker.aspx?vin=3LN6XXXXXXXXXXXX using your VIN number (replace the red numbers with your VIN...). You'll probably get various error messages, but mainly VIN NOT FOUND, so I'd try about once a day... Magically, after about 2 weeks or so, the VIN number will suddenly start to work. Apparently this happens when the vehicle is now actually scheduled to be built soon. It's very reassuring to see your window sticker pop up. #3 Now that you have a VIN, register for a Sync account here: http://www.syncmyride.com Once there, create a new car, using your VIN number above. You may get errors that this VIN number doesn't exist. #4 On this web site, periodically check the "Sync Updates" feature. Until there's actually a car out there, you'll get errors... But magically, about 10 days after you get the VIN, possibly sooner, the Sync updates will start showing what Sync version your car has, and what updates are already installed. About two days after this started working for me, I got an email from my dealer that my car was completed, and was in shipping... The current expectation is about 20 days... I'll keep you posted.... At least for me it was nice to see that there was finally a car out there with my name on it :)
